The Actors Studio

We recently teamed up with photographer Michele Aboud, hair stylist Michael Wolff and make-up artist Justine Purdue to shoot a story that takes it cues from 1950s New York. Our direct inspiration was the famous Actors Studio on W 44th St in Manhattan, where Lee Strasberg developed the method acting technique. The result was a modern take on the aesthetics, silhouettes and energy of, among others, Marilyn Monroe, James Dean and Sidney Poitier. And with gorgeous models to boot. Peruvian Fashion





The second installment in our irregular series on fashions from around the globe. I travelled to Peru recently and was amazed at the colour palette and layering of tradition highland wardrobe despite 30 degree heat. Flashbacks of Marnie Skilling circa 2008, woolen stirruped leg warmers, cardigans, knee length pleated skirts and felt hats. As per Cambodia, plastic shopping bags in complimentary colours.
